When cyclohexane is subjected to Gif-type oxidation conditions in the presence of sufficient H2S, Na2S or (in Gif(III)) S8, the normal oxidation process is replaced by the formation of dicyclohexyl di- and poly-sulfides.

investigation explores the functional features of several novel and other previously ill-defined ferrous and ferric complexes of the picolinic acid anion (Pic), which are used to mediate Gif-type oxidation of hydrocarbons by H2O2. The reactionbetween [Fe(pic)3] and hydrogen peroxide in pyridine under GoAggIII (Fe(III)/Hpic catalyst) conditions was investigated by UV-visible spectrophotometry.
